No.1 Circuit Standings Leaders Heading Into Cowboy Christmas Run

Cowboy Christmas is just around the corner, and ProRodeo breakaway ropers are gearing up to compete during the Fourth of July run for their chance at a Top-15 finish in the PRCA/WPRA world standings as well as a Top-12 finish in their respective circuits.

Here is a full, circuit-by-circuit list of the current leaders as of June 22, 2022:

Badlands

Taylor Engesser continues to dominate the Badlands Circuit and wins another $1,128 for her 2.4-second run to win second at the Newtown Breakaway Roping.

  1. Taylor Engesser — Spearfish, SD ◦ $4,901.39
  2. Brandy Schaack — Chadron, NE ◦ $3,087.32
  3. Shayna Deal — Faith, SD ◦ $3,042.85

California

New circuit leader!

Allie Hoskins takes the top spot in the California Circuit with a 3.4-second run at the Santa Maria Breakaway Roping, adding $1,435 to her earnings.

  1. Allie Hoskins — San Juan Baustista, CA ◦ $3,719.01
  2. Hanna Hundsdorfer — Exeter, CA ◦ $3,514.75
  3. Fallon Ruffoni — Arroyo Grande, CA ◦ $3,246.76

Columbia River

Mattie Turner holds onto her lead in the Columbia River Circuit and adds $1,021 to her earnings with a tie for first place at the Basin City Breakaway Roping with a 2.8-second run.

  1. Mattie Turner — Wilsonville, OR ◦ $3,965.39
  2. Brittany White — Jordan Valley, OR ◦ $2,760.96
  3. Samantha Kerns — Silver Lake, OR ◦ $2,011.60

First Frontier

Kelsey King keeps her lead in the First Frontier Circuit and adds $639 to her earnings by placing first at the Woodstown Breakaway in 3.4 seconds.

  1. Kelsey King — Honey Brook, PA ◦ $2,681.70
  2. DeNiess Kilgus — Watsontown, PA ◦ $1,722.0
  3. Emily Fabian — Gansevort, NY ◦ $1,504.00

Great Lakes

Halle Tatham continues to hold the lead in the Great Lakes Circuit and adds an extra $470 to her current earnings with a fifth-place win at the Merrill Breakaway Roping for a 6.2-second run. 

  1. Halle Tatham — Pryor, OK ◦ $5,324.32
  2. Cali Griffin — Sperry, OK ◦ $2,227.80
  3. Sierra Smith — Winterset, IA ◦ $1,773.54

Maple Leaf

New circuit leader!

Taylor Flewelling explodes to the top of the Maple Leaf Circuit with a 2.27 for $1,246.96 at the Red Deer County Breakaway Roping and a 2.51 for $1,166.54 at the Stavely Breakaway Roping.

  1. Taylor Flewelling — La Cumbe, AB ◦ $4,251.19
  2. Kendal Pierson — Wardlow, AB ◦ $3,273.08
  3. Lakota Bird — Nanton, AB ◦ $2,878.28

Montana

Jacey Fortier holds the lead on the Montana Circuit after winning the Belt (MT) Breakaway Roping with a time of 2.6 seconds and cashing in $1,690 for her first-place finish.

  1. Jacey Fortier — Billings, MT ◦ $1,690.12
  2. Molly Salmond — Choteau, MT ◦ $1,398.72
  3. Tracey Bolich — Belgrade, MT ◦ $1,107.32

Mountain States

Erin Johnson maintains her lead in the Mountain States Circuit.

  1. Erin Johnson — Fowler, CO ◦ $2,516.85
  2. Peggy Garman — Sundance, WY ◦ $1,956.61
  3. Karly Teller — Ault, CO ◦ $1,701.40

Prairie

New circuit leader!

Addie Weil clinches the top spot in the Prairie Circuit after winning the Hugo Breakaway Roping in 1.4 seconds for $2,487, tied for sixth at the Woodward Breakaway Roping in 2.6 seconds for $1,042, and tied for sixth at the North Platte Breakaway Roping in 2.9 seconds for $947.

  1. Addie Weil — Edna, KS ◦ $7,372.98
  2. Taylor Munsell — Alva, OK ◦ $6,685.75
  3. Kamie Landolfi — Coleman, OK ◦ $4,530.80

READ MORE: Kamie Landolfi Climbs Resistol Rookie Standings with Woodward Breakaway Win

Southeastern

Lacey Nail continues to hold the top spot in the Southeastern Circuit adding a third place win and $214 to her earnings at the Kissimmee Breakaway Roping with a 4.1-second run.

  1. Lacey Nail — Okeechobee, FL ◦ $1,947.30
  2. Shelby Osceola — Troy, AL ◦ $1,853.41
  3. Makayla Mack — Christmas, FL ◦ $1,723.58

Texas

Matha Angelone continues to dominate the Texas Circuit, winning sixth place with a 2.7-second run at Big Spring Breakaway Roping for $765 in earnings.

  1. Martha Angelone — Stephenville, TX ◦ $15,900.02
  2. JJ Hampton — Stephenville, TX ◦ $15,006.73
  3. Lari Dee Guy — Abilene, TX ◦ $10,309.83

Turquoise

Leigh Ann Scribner maintains her lead in the Turquoise Circuit.

  1. Leigh Ann Scribner — Edgewood, NM ◦ $4,218.58
  2. Cheyenne Blackmore — Hillside, AZ ◦ $3,008.00
  3. Justine Doka — Fountain Hills, AZ ◦ $2,498.05

Wilderness

Oaklie Sanders maintains her lead in the Wilderness Circuit after tying for fourth place with a time of 3.2 seconds at the Pony Express Rodeo Breakaway and earning $649.

  1. Oaklie Sanders — Taylor, UT ◦ $3,056.88
  2. Sammy Taylor — Neola, UT ◦ $2,825.64
  3. Delaney Kunau — Declo, ID ◦ $2,127.40
